Frequently asked questions about Foundation Academy

How many students attend Foundation Academy?

Foundation Academy has 382 students enrolled. It is an elementary school in Mansfield, OH. CCD year-over-year: 460 (2022-23) → 431 (2023-24), down 29.

What is the student-teacher ratio at Foundation Academy?

The student-teacher ratio at Foundation Academy is 16.6:1, which is 9% lower than the Ohio average of 18.2:1 and 6% higher than the national average of 15.7:1. Lower ratios generally mean more individual attention per student.

What is the racial and ethnic makeup of Foundation Academy?

The largest demographic group at Foundation Academy is White at 47.9% of enrollment, in Mansfield, OH. Its student body is more racially and ethnically mixed than most US schools, with a diversity index of 64.5/100.
